CSS最佳实践
以下是一些关于CSS的常见最佳实践,可以帮助您编写更加高效、可维护的代码。
1. 使用类选择器而非标签选择器
使用类选择器可以更精确地定位元素,避免过度使用标签选择器导致的性能问题。
<div class="example">
<p class="text">
2. 保持代码的可读性
- 使用缩进来表示代码块结构。
- 使用空格和换行符使代码更易于阅读。
- 避免使用过多的嵌套。
3. 使用CSS预处理器
使用Sass、Less等CSS预处理器可以提升开发效率,如变量、嵌套、混合等特性。
4. 使用媒体查询
响应式设计是现代网页设计的重要组成部分。使用媒体查询可以为不同屏幕尺寸提供不同的样式。
@media screen and (max-width: 768px) {
.example {
font-size: 14px;
}
}
5. 使用注释
合理地使用注释可以帮助他人更好地理解您的代码。
/* 这是注释,用于说明样式的作用 */
.example {
color: red;
}
6. 避免使用ID选择器
ID选择器是全局唯一的,过多使用会降低CSS的可维护性。
7. 使用字体图标库
使用字体图标库可以减少图片的使用,提高页面加载速度。
8. 使用CSS框架
使用Bootstrap、Foundation等CSS框架可以快速搭建网页界面。